在数字化转型的浪潮中,低代码开发平台凭借其高效、便捷的特点,受到了越来越多开发者和企业的青睐。低代码GUI(Graphical User Interface,图形用户界面)作为低代码开发平台的重要组成部分,使得开发者能够轻松搭建出美观、实用的可视化界面。本文将揭秘低代码GUI的奥秘,帮助您解锁编程新境界。
一、什么是低代码GUI?
低代码GUI是一种无需编写大量代码,通过可视化拖拽组件的方式,快速构建应用程序用户界面的开发工具。它将复杂的界面设计工作简化为拖拽、配置组件的过程,极大地提高了开发效率。
二、低代码GUI的优势
提高开发效率:低代码GUI将界面设计工作从代码编写中解放出来,让开发者专注于业务逻辑的实现,从而提高开发效率。
降低开发成本:低代码GUI减少了代码量,降低了开发难度,使得开发团队可以更快地交付项目,从而降低开发成本。
易于学习和使用:低代码GUI操作简单,无需深厚的编程基础,即使是非技术人员也能轻松上手。
跨平台兼容:低代码GUI开发的应用程序可以运行在多种操作系统和设备上,满足不同用户的需求。
三、低代码GUI的常用组件
按钮:用于触发事件,如提交表单、打开新窗口等。
文本框:用于输入和显示文本内容。
下拉菜单:用于选择一个选项。
日期选择器:用于选择日期。
表格:用于展示和编辑数据。
图表:用于可视化数据。
图片:用于展示图片。
视频:用于播放视频。
四、低代码GUI开发流程
需求分析:明确应用程序的功能和界面需求。
选择低代码GUI开发平台:根据需求选择合适的低代码GUI开发平台。
设计界面:使用可视化拖拽组件的方式设计应用程序界面。
配置组件属性:对组件进行属性配置,如字体、颜色、大小等。
编写业务逻辑:使用平台提供的编程语言或脚本编写业务逻辑。
测试和发布:对应用程序进行测试,确保其功能和性能满足需求,然后发布上线。
五、低代码GUI的应用场景
企业内部应用:如员工管理系统、客户关系管理系统等。
移动应用开发:如电商平台、O2O应用等。
物联网应用开发:如智能家居、智能穿戴设备等。
教育领域:如在线课程平台、学习管理系统等。
六、总结
低代码GUI为开发者提供了一个高效、便捷的界面开发工具,使得构建美观、实用的应用程序变得更加简单。随着低代码技术的不断发展,相信低代码GUI将在更多领域发挥重要作用,助力编程新境界的解锁。
